Loctite LB 8008 C5-A Copper Based Anti-Seize Lubricant is a premium lubricant designed specifically to protect metal parts from rust, corrosion, and seizing. Ideal for automotive and industrial applications, this anti-seize lubricant is essential for maintaining the longevity and performance of metal components under extreme conditions.
This unique formula combines copper and graphite suspended in a high-quality grease, enabling it to withstand temperatures up to 1800 degrees Fahrenheit. It is particularly effective in preventing galling and ensuring that metal parts operate smoothly, making it an essential tool for mechanics, engineers, and DIY enthusiasts alike.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What is the size of the Loctite 51001 C5-A Copper Based Anti-Seize Lubricant?A: The size is one ounce. It comes in a tube that is compact and easy to handle.
Q: What materials are used in the Loctite anti-seize lubricant?A: It contains copper and graphite suspended in a high-quality grease. This combination helps prevent rust and corrosion.
Q: What are the dimensions of the product packaging?A: The item package dimensions are eight point five inches long by six inches wide by five point five inches high. It weighs four point fourteen pounds.
Q: How do I apply the Loctite anti-seize lubricant?A: You should apply it directly to the threaded parts or surfaces. Make sure to use a thin, even layer for best results.
Q: Is this lubricant suitable for all metal types?A: Yes, it is suitable for various metal types. It effectively protects against rust and seizing in most applications.
Q: Can I use this lubricant on high-temperature applications?A: Yes, it can withstand temperatures up to one thousand eight hundred degrees Fahrenheit. This makes it ideal for high-heat environments.
Q: How should I store the Loctite anti-seize lubricant?A: Store it in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. This will help maintain its effectiveness over time.
Q: Is this lubricant environmentally hazardous?A: Yes, it is classified as an environmentally hazardous substance. Handle it with care and follow disposal guidelines.
Q: How do I clean up if I spill the lubricant?A: Clean spills with an appropriate absorbent material. Ensure that you dispose of it according to local regulations.
